Output ec257bebcf5cd429cda64b95422534e2a5381d97f899dac49997f9186815a6c2:1

value
20399510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b848206b420fd8b53e2d319a7db4ec94b4339b OP_EQUAL
address
MFzGTRyLRzpMLmEZmYHN7X3rEWw9dNEXss
transaction
ec257bebcf5cd429cda64b95422534e2a5381d97f899dac49997f9186815a6c2
spent
true